OpenAI models
OpenAI ships the GPT line, the most widely used family of AI models in the world. On Zeplik the catalog spans the current GPT-5.6 generation (Sol, Luna and Terra, each with a Pro serving) down to earlier GPT-5 and GPT-4 era releases, plus mini and nano tiers for fast, inexpensive work.
